Peel and slice your cucumbers so that they are about 1/4" thick and place them in the container.
Cut the onion in half and thinly slice it. Add the slices to the container with the cucumbers.
Peel and crush 3 garlic cloves and add to the container.
Rinse and roughly chop the dill and add to the container.
In another bowl or a large liquid measuring cup add 2 cups of white vinegar. Add 1/3 cup sugar directly to the vinegar and stir to dissolve. Dilute the mixture with 6 cups of water and pour over the vegetables in the container.
Move the container to the refrigerator and let it soak for several hours before serving. The salad can be stored in the refrigerator for several days and enjoyed.
Notes
Be careful of the container that you choose to store your cucumber salad. A plastic container will absorb the smell of vinegar and onions, but glass will not.
